An increase in FHA mortgage insurance claims poses a threat to the FHA loan program. Just in 2018, FHA cash-out refinances increased by about 60% compared to total refinances. Also during 2018, 25% of all FHA forward loans closed with over a 50% debt to income ratio. That is the highest percentage since 2000, which is not a good sign. Finally.
Fha Federal Housing Authority AllGov – Departments – Overview: The Federal Housing Administration (FHA) is a division within the Department of Housing and Urban development (hud). founded in 1934 to revive a housing industry leveled by the Great Depression, FHA sought to stimulate homeownership by providing mortgage insurance and regulating interest rates.

Mortgage Insurance (MIP) for FHA Insured Loan Mortgage insurance is a policy that protects lenders against losses that result from defaults on home mortgages. fha requires both upfront and annual mortgage insurance for all borrowers, regardless of the amount of down payment.

FHA Mortgage Insurance Premium Refund Fast Facts. Here’s a few good things to know about FHA MIP refunds: When doing an FHA to FHA refinance, your refund will be applied to the upfront mortgage insurance premium on the new loan. mip refunds are available for an FHA streamline refinance after the 7-month waiting period required for these loans.
